N.Y. Womens F/W 07 – JASON WU

For his second ready to wear collection, Jason Wu warms up his classic glamor woman and gives her countless options. The opening section is a series of all black looks, from the outerwear piece to the cocktail dresses. One of the standout outerwear pieces in the opening section is a black wool coat with ¾ length sleeves and worn with a mustard yellow leather belt. The collar of the coat is encrusted with pearled beads. Wu touched on a few of last season’s trends like brocade fabrics and 50’s style cape jackets. The second section is a highlight of a little color, mainly red and yellow with a lot of metallic silver. The silhouettes from the opening to second sections are all over the place. No clear defined silhouette statement in the whole collection. For evening Wu only showed 6 gowns, all floor length and all draped with a romantic full silhouette. One of the standout gowns is the red silk taffeta empire waist gown. The fabrics drapes to the floor with a slight slope in the front showing off the red silk satin fabric underskirt.

The two must have pieces are from the opening section. First is a wide neck silk jacquard dress with an elbow length sleeve and pencil skirt shape with a flare at the hem. The other must have piece is a silver brocade fabric jacket. The tailoring is very simple but the silver brocade as an unique look. The look of the collection is still reminiscent of his passion in designing clothes for doll collections. Absent is his sense of adventure in creating unique pieces and looks. While the whole collection is easily a commercial success, editorially this collection might hurt Wu with very few eye please pieces.
